Hi My baby is 1 year old.. she keeps her feet outward while standing, cruising with furniture and while pushing walker..I have attached the picture for reference.. I want to know is this normal and will it correct on its own??

1 Answer
profile image of RashmiRashmiMom of a 11 yr 2 m old girl1 month ago

A. The child doesn’t have proper grip in this age on their legs I have seen the same problem with my own child but when I asked my doctor the doctor told me that within five years of age the things are going to proper child will learn to keep the feet straight and aligned and actually that happened so right now with what you are mentioning is very normal for kids
